WebMar 24, 2024 · A positive proper divisor is a positive divisor of a number n, excluding n itself. For example, 1, 2, and 3 are positive proper divisors of 6, but 6 itself is not. WebMar 31, 2024 · IMPORTANT CONCEPT: A perfect square (the square of an integer) will always have an ODD number of positive divisors. For example, 25 has 3 positive divisors: 1, 5 and 25 Likewise, 16 has 5 positive divisors 1, 2, 4, 8 and 16 And 100 has 9 positive divisors 1, 2, 4, 5, 10, 20, 25, 50 and 100----- WebJun 23, 2024 · Given a natural number, calculate sum of all its proper divisors.
